San Diego FC, Minnesota United Square Off in Battle for No. 2 in West

Summary by Clayton News
Second place in the Western Conference will be up for grabs when San Diego FC and Minnesota United kick off the second half of their MLS seasons on Saturday night in Saint Paul, Minn.

Oluwatimikhin Oluwaseyi and Minnesota United host San Diego FC

This Saturday afternoon the San Diego FC faces Minnesota United, on day 18 of the season. San Diego FC that comes from winning 2-0 at home against Austin FC is preparing to face Minnesota United that are tied with 30 points each. San Diego that has had a lot of difficulty visiting, faces some of the best teams in the league and will seek to follow the good streak and get the 3 points.
